Does US protect Korea

The US-ROK Mutual Defense Treaty is a key part of the security relationship between the United States and South Korea. The Treaty, signed in 1953, commits the United States to help South Korea defend itself, particularly from North Korea. Approximately 28,500 US troops are based in the ROK, and the Treaty helps to ensure their safety.

Is the US enemy of North Korea?

The United States and North Korea have a long history of tension and hostility between them. There are no diplomatic relations between the two countries, and the Swedish Embassy in Pyongyang serves as the US protecting power. This provides limited consular services to US citizens.

The foreign relations of North Korea have been shaped by its conflict with South Korea and its historical ties with world communism. North Korea has been an ally of China and the Soviet Union since the Korean War, and it remains close to both countries today. North Korea’s relations with the West have been strained by its nuclear weapons program and its human rights record.

Are China and America allies?

Currently, the United States and China have mutual political, economic, and security interests, such as the non-proliferation of nuclear weapons, but there are unresolved concerns relating to China’s relations with Taiwan and whether the US continues to acknowledge the One China policy, the role of democracy in China, and human rights. These concerns could lead to tension and conflict between the two countries.

Why is US Army still in Korea

The US presence in South Korea is a key part of the US government’s Asia-Pacific rebalancing strategy. With 28,500 troops in the country, US forces are a major contributor to regional stability and security. The US-South Korea alliance is essential to preserving peace and security in Northeast Asia and to deterring aggression from North Korea.
